he playersand teamsinGriffey

MLB

are basedonactualteamstatsandreflectthe realstrengthsandweaknesses ofthe28 Major Leagueteams.But youcanwin con-sistentlywithanyteamineither thePlaying orManaging mode, even onewith a losing reputation.Conversely,choosingthe

BlueJayswon'tguarantee a win.The jfgjg

mostimportant factorisyourskillon

99

the field

hitting,pitchingandfield-

ra

ing.The computer opponent makes fewerrorsanditsdecisions arealways instantaneous.Ifyou're playing

BS

againstanother person at a different

H

skilllevel,youcaneventheoddsa bitaSM

bychoosingtheAuto Fielding optionforoneor

both oT you.The second mostimportant factorishow youmanage yourteam.How

longdoyouleta pitcher stay inthegame?Can youput

togetherabetterlineup beforethegame?

Do

you make smart base running

decisions?

Working yourway throughallof the levelsofSuper EmpireStrikesBack canbe very challenging, especially

when youtakeonDarthVaderhimself.Becauseit’sso tough,mostplayerscouldn’tviewthe finishing credits. .

..untilnow!Ifyouquickly enter thefollowing code

whileyouareontheGameSelectScreen, allof the cred-itscan be seen, without all of thework.As soonas the screenappears,pressA,B,A,B,A, B, A, then B. Ifyou

enter thecodecorrectly, thecredits willbegin to roll.

Agent#745hasdiscovered a greatcodefor Inspector

Gadgetthatallows players to access thehiddenDebug Modeof thegame.Whenthe TitleScreen first appears,

holddownthe L,R,andB Buttons on ControllerI.

While holdingthesebuttons,quickly press Down, Down, Up,Left,Right,Down,Right,then Left. Ifyou

enter thecodecorrectly, the TitleScreenshouldturn pink.Release allof the Buttons then press Start.Before

thegamebegins, aMenu Screenwillappearthatwill giveyouaStage Select,OptionMenu, andaSoundTest.

Withthiscode, thegameshouldbe a breeze to finish.

One ofthebestwaystorackup yourscore inKirby’s PinballLandisbyfinding theBonus Rounds. Because

they aresohardto find,manyplayersdon't score well

whentheydofindthem.To becomefamiliarwith the

Bonus Games,use thiscodetoaccess allofthem from

thebeginningof thegame.

On

the TitleScreen, press Left,B andtheSelectButtonatthesametime.Whenthe screenchangestotheHigh ScoreScreen, a white cat will

walkacross thebottom.Returntothe TitleScreenand

begin playing anew game.

When

youselectastage to play,youwillautomaticallygototheBonusGame.

NOTE:

You can’t getahigh score withthis trick,

because youcan’t loseyourball.
